Vibrant Moroccan Rugs: A Legacy of Craftsmanship

Moroccan rugs have captivated the world with their intense colors and intricate designs. Each rug is a testament to the talented hands that craft them, passing down centuries-old techniques from generation to generation. The multifaceted nature of these rugs allows them to elevate any interior, adding a touch of cultural richness.

From the geometric patterns of the Beni Ourain to the vibrant hues of the Boujaad, each region in Morocco features its own characteristic style. These rugs are not merely floor coverings; they are expressions of heritage that tell a story of Moroccan history and heritage.
